Graphic Packaging Holding Company revenue & earnings — last 10 fiscal years
| Metric | 2016 | 2017 | 2018 |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| 2023 | 2024 | 2025 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Revenue | $4.30B | $4.41B | $6.03B | $6.16B | $6.56B | $7.16B | $9.44B | $9.43B | $8.81B | $8.62B |
| Gross profit | $791.90M | $719.50M | $952.40M | $1.09B | $1.10B | $1.07B | $1.83B | $2.12B | $1.96B | $1.60B |
| Net income | $228.00M | $300.20M | $221.10M | $207.00M | $167.00M | $204.00M | $522.00M | $723.00M | $658.00M | $444.00M |
| Net margin | 5.3% | 6.8% | 3.7% | 3.4% | 2.5% | 2.9% | 5.5% | 7.7% | 7.5% | 5.2% |
Source: Graphic Packaging Holding Company SEC filings (10-K). 17 years of history available in the interactive view.

About Graphic Packaging Holding Company
Graphic Packaging Holding Company,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the design, production, and sale of consumer packaging products to brands in food, beverage, foodservice, household, and other consumer products in the Americas, Europe, and the Asia Pacific. It operates through two segments, Americas Paperboard Packaging and International Paperboard Packaging. The Americas Paperboard Packaging segment includes paperboard packaging sold primarily to consumer packaged goods (CPG) companies serving the food, beverage and consumer product markets and cups, lids and food containers sold primarily to foodservice companies and quick-service restaurants in the Americas. The International Paperboard Packaging includes paperboard packaging sold primarily to CPG companies serving the food, foodservice, beverage and consumer product markets, including healthcare and beauty, outside of the Americas. It also designs, manufactures, and installs specialized packaging machines. The company sells its products through sales offices, as well as through broker arrangements with third parties. Graphic Packaging Holding Company was incorporated in 2007 and is head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ia.

What is Graphic Packaging Holding Company's revenue?
Graphic Packaging Holding Company (GPK) reported revenue of $8.62B for fiscal year 2025, down 2.2% from the prior year, according to its SEC filings.
Is Graphic Packaging Holding Company profitable?
Yes. GPK earned net income of $444.00M in fiscal 2025, a net margin of 5.2%.
